WebThe name Finrod is composed of fin meaning "hair" and arod meaning noble. It was the Sindarin form of his original name Findaráto, which was in the Telerin language of his mother's people. WebThis name was given because of Finrod’s skill in lighter stone-carving. He cut many of the adornments of the pillars and walls in Nargothrond. He was proud of the name. It is fitting that Finrod should be proud of the name Felagund, since his skill in working with stone is one of the ways in which he is unique among his peers.
